Near and Distance Vision in One Lens
Traditional bifocal sunglasses feature a visible line separating the distance and near vision segments. Some modern designs, such as progressive lenses, offer a gradual transition between vision segments, making them far less noticeable while keeping the same functional benefit. Either way, the lens does the switching automatically - look up to see far, look down to read. It becomes second nature within minutes.
Ideal for Presbyopia Sufferers
Presbyopia - the gradual loss of near-focusing ability that typically sets in during the mid-40s - affects a large portion of the population. For anyone managing that condition, outdoor life used to mean a constant compromise: either squint at fine print or sacrifice sun protection. Bifocal sunglasses close that gap entirely, offering clear vision at both distances while simultaneously protecting eyes from glare and UV exposure.
UV400 Protection: The Non-Negotiable Feature
Of all the specs on a pair of sunglasses, UV400 protection is the one that should never be treated as optional. It is the baseline for actual eye safety outdoors, and skipping it - even in a stylish, well-tinted lens - carries real health consequences.
What UV400 Actually Blocks
UV400 means the lenses block all UVA and UVB rays up to a wavelength of 400 nanometers. That covers the full spectrum of harmful ultraviolet radiation that reaches the eyes during outdoor exposure. Prolonged UV exposure without protection is linked to cataracts, age-related macular degeneration (AMD), and photokeratitis - essentially a sunburn on the surface of the eye. UV400 lenses address all of that.
The Hidden Risk of Tinted Lenses Without UV400
Here is the counterintuitive part: a dark-tinted lens with no UV protection can be worse than wearing nothing at all. The tint causes pupils to dilate in response to reduced visible light - but if the lens is not filtering UV rays, those dilated pupils are letting in more harmful radiation than they would in bright sunlight without glasses. Always verify the UV400 rating before purchasing, regardless of how dark the lens looks.
Why Polycarbonate Lenses Win Outdoors
Lens material matters enormously for outdoor use, and polycarbonate consistently comes out on top for active wearers.
Aerospace-Grade Durability, Featherlight Fit
Polycarbonate was originally developed for aerospace and high-tech safety applications - cockpit canopies, bulletproof glass, protective gear. That lineage translates directly to eyewear: polycarbonate lenses are exceptionally impact-resistant, far more so than standard plastic or glass, and they handle drops, knocks, and rough handling without shattering. They also inherently block 100% of UV rays, with no additional coating required.
Despite that toughness, polycarbonate is remarkably lightweight. For anyone wearing sunglasses through hours of outdoor activity, that reduced weight translates to noticeably less nose and temple pressure over time.

Polarized vs. Standard: Which Lens Is Right for You?
This is one of the more practical decisions when choosing bifocal sunglasses, and the right answer depends on the primary activity.
Polarized lenses contain a chemical filter that blocks horizontally oriented light waves - the kind that create glare off flat, reflective surfaces like water, wet roads, sand, and car hoods. For fishing, boating, beach activities, or driving, polarized lenses offer dramatically improved comfort and clarity. Glare reduction also reduces eye fatigue during long outdoor sessions.
Standard (non-polarized) lenses with UV400 protection handle general outdoor use well and typically come at a lower price point. They are a solid choice for gardening, walking, café use, or any activity where reflective glare is not the primary concern. Some users also find that polarized lenses make digital screens harder to read at certain angles - worth knowing before committing.
A simple rule of thumb: if the activity involves water, roads, or highly reflective environments, polarized is worth the upgrade. For everything else, a quality UV400 standard lens performs reliably.
